DE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2018 in Review

1,169 of the 4,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Deere & Co (DE) for Q2 2018, worth a combined $30.8B — down 10% from $34.4B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 103 funds closed out of DE and 92 opened new positions — a net loss of 11 holders — while 433 trimmed existing stakes and 407 added.

The largest buyer was Third Point, opening a new position worth an estimated $162M. The largest seller was Senator Investment Group, exiting entirely with an estimated $140M sold.
